Find Landscape Design Pros in OrlandoOrlando landscape design spans the manicured estates of Winter Park and Isleworth to the master-planned communities of Lake Nona, Baldwin Park, and Horizon West. Central Florida's year-round growing season supports a broad plant palette — from tropicals like bougainvillea and crotons to Florida natives like firebush, muhly grass, and saw palmetto. HOA-governed Orange County communities typically require architectural review for significant landscape changes, and the best Orlando designers balance ornamental appeal with Florida-friendly water-wise principles that align with SJRWMD conservation standards.

Top performers include coontie, firebush, beautyberry, Walter's viburnum, Muhly grass, wax myrtle, and Simpson's stopper. For color, pentas, salvia, and bougainvillea thrive in the summer heat.
Choose native plants appropriate for your soil and sun conditions, install a drip irrigation system, use 3-inch mulch layers to suppress weeds, and minimize lawn area. A landscape designer familiar with Florida-friendly principles can create a yard that requires minimal watering, fertilizing, and pest control.
